I'd stick with the Pajero. The M-ASTC system makes it virtually brainless to drive off-road. It just keeps going! Perfect for those who are not seasoned off-roaders who suddenly find themselves in a low traction situation.
For road use, four wheel independent suspension and a stiff monocoque chassis are hard to beat. Third seat is a disappearing type. Interior is easy to keep clean.
Local Prado is too bare for the price. Unless you really love Toyotas.

Yep, but stock for stock the Pajero is a no-brainer in light to semi-serious stuff. The Prado will only go its full potential with a good driver. The Pajero is point and shoot.
GEN III's are lifted by inserting a spacer between the subframe (where the suspension is attached) and the monocoque chassis. Parang body lift but of a different kind.
